The Importance of ADHD Diagnosis
Before we discuss expenses, it's vital to comprehend the significance of obtaining an appropriate diagnosis. ADHD can manifest in different types, impacting attention span, impulse control, and overall executive working. A timely diagnosis can lead to appropriate interventions that significantly enhance quality of life, academic performance, and social relationships.

Typically, the assessment process starts with a preliminary consultation. During this session, the clinician will gather background details and talk about the individual's signs in detail. This action is crucial for forming a foundational understanding of the person's difficulties and history.
Comprehensive Diagnostic Test
This is typically the most significant expenditure in the assessment procedure. A comprehensive evaluation might consist of interviews, standardized tests, and behavioral observations. Aspects such as the clinician's proficiency and the methodologies utilized contribute to variations in costs.
Follow-up Consultation
After the assessment is total, a follow-up session might be necessary to go over the outcomes and possible treatment options, consisting of the possibility of treatment or medication.
ADHD Rating Scales & & Questionnaires
Clinicians frequently make use of standardized rating scales and questionnaires to compare outcomes with normative information. These tools provide insights into the severity and impact of symptoms.
Additional Services
Some people may gain from extra supports such as therapy or counseling, which can contribute to the overall cost. Sessions can range significantly, depending upon the service provider's rates and session frequency.
Elements Affecting Cost
Geographical Location: Costs can differ dramatically based upon where the service is situated. Urban areas tend to be more costly than rural places.
Clinician's Expertise: Specialists or more experienced clinicians typically charge greater fees due to their credentials and substantial experience.
Insurance Coverage and Payment Options: While some personal practices accept insurance coverage, lots of do not. This can significantly impact out-of-pocket expenditures. It's vital to verify insurance protection in advance.
Scope of Evaluation: The depth of the evaluation will affect the expense. Comprehensive assessments that represent co-existing conditions may be more costly.
Need for Follow-up: Additional assessments or continuous treatment can increase general costs.
Often Asked Questions1. Is a personal ADHD diagnosis worth the cost?
Numerous individuals think that the convenience and speed of a private diagnosis deserve the expense, particularly if they are dealing with long wait times with public services. A prompt diagnosis can cause rapid interventions, which might be crucial for scholastic and personal success.
2. Will insurance cover the cost of a personal ADHD diagnosis?
This differs by supplier and strategy. Some insurance coverage plans may cover part of the diagnostic process, while others may not. Always contact your insurance coverage service provider before arranging an appointment.
3. How long does the diagnosis procedure take?
The entire process from preliminary assessment to receiving outcomes can take anywhere from a few days to several weeks, depending on the clinician's schedule and the comprehensiveness of the assessment.
4. Can I get a refund if I alter my mind about pursuing a diagnosis?
Refund policies vary by clinician or center. It is recommended to clarify cancellation and refund policies during the initial assessment.
5. Exist any inexpensive choices available for ADHD evaluation?
Some non-profit companies or universities with psychology programs may offer low-priced or sliding-scale evaluations. Researching regional resources can yield possible options for those on a tight budget.
